Australian man extradited to Saudi Arabia was cleared of criminal charges years earlier, Human Rights Watch says

An Australian man extradited to Saudi Arabia was actually cleared two years ago of the criminal charges used to seek his extradition, according to a Saudi court document obtained by a global rights body.
